@theduckofdeath: Depends EMP grenades are used to prevent players/Enemies from deploying any skills and also for disabling any enemy/player skills that may have been tossed out.

Basically if an enemy is hit by an EMP grenade they wont be able to heal or throw out turrets etc. Same thing with the Shock turret except thats used more for locking an enemy down so a team can focus fire them or prevent the enemy from running up on them.

A couple of key things that are wrong in this.

You need level 31 gear for the Hard mode of the Incursion but for the Challenge mode there is a minimum required Gear score and its highly recommended to have multiple pieces of the new gear from the hard mode incursion before you even attempt challenge mode.

Its no longer called Falcons lost its called Last stronghold (They recently changed it in game but failed to mention it in the stream). Its also going to require teams with different loadouts to deal with the different mechanics.
